upstream/beta independently shipped 108_seed_sl_email_template_translations.js
(Slovenian email template translations) using the migration number
this branch had already claimed for 108_add_backup_paths.js. Knex's
filename-based ordering would have caused both to attempt the slot
at merge time.
Renamed via `git mv` so file history is preserved. All five
references updated in lockstep:
- backend/src/services/_backupPathsBoot.js (require + comments)
- backend/src/services/backupService.js (LEGACY_BACKUP_PATHS comment)
- 3 integration test files (require + "migration 108" prose)
- migration's own header comment, with a paragraph explaining the
rename so reviewers don't wonder why the number jumped
**No data-migration impact for installs that already ran the
108-named version** (Ralf's beta, primarily): the migration's body
is idempotent — createTable is guarded by `hasTable`, and the seed
uses `onConflict('path').ignore()`. So when 109 runs against an
install whose backup_paths table is already populated, both the
schema step and the seed step no-op cleanly. The orphaned
`108_add_backup_paths.js` row in the `migrations` tracking table
sits harmlessly alongside the new `109_add_backup_paths.js` row.
No data lost, no double-insert, no schema drift. Mechanical rename
ahead of the PR opening.

// NOTE on walker duplication
|
|
//
|
|
// If two `backup_paths` rows overlap (e.g. one row at `events` AND
|
|
// another at `events/active`), the walker scans the same files twice
|
|
// — once via each path. Per-path stats then attribute the file to the
|
|
// longest-prefix-matching path BOTH times, producing inflated counts.
|
|
//
|
|
// The canonical seed in migration 109 contains no overlapping pairs,
|
|
// so this isn't exercised in practice. But an admin who hand-adds a
|
|
// broad row that overlaps an existing nested one will see double
|
|
// counts in their next backup's statistics + the destination will
|
|
// receive duplicate copies (wasting space). Worth flagging if anyone
|
|
// reports it — the fix is to de-dupe `files` in
|
|
// `getFilesToBackupInternal` before returning, OR to skip walking a
|
|
// path if a longer one has already covered it.
